How much do insurance sales trainer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for insurance sales trainer in Ohio is $65,225.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$47,500.00 and $76,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an insurance sales trainer?

To thrive as an Insurance Sales Trainer, you need a deep understanding of insurance products, sales processes, and adult learning principles, typically backed by experience in insurance sales and training certifications. Familiarity with learning management systems (LMS), CRM software, and virtual meeting platforms is important for delivering and tracking training programs. Strong interpersonal skills, motivational abilities, and clear communication help trainers engage trainees and foster a productive learning environment. These combined skills ensure effective knowledge transfer, improved sales performance, and alignment with organizational goals.

What are some common challenges insurance sales trainers face and how can they overcome them?

Insurance Sales Trainers often encounter challenges such as engaging diverse groups of learners with varying levels of experience and keeping training content current with regulatory and product changes. Successful trainers address these challenges by employing interactive training techniques, leveraging technology for blended learning, and regularly updating materials in collaboration with product and compliance teams. Building strong relationships with sales teams helps trainers understand specific needs and customize their approach accordingly. By staying adaptable and proactive, trainers can ensure continuous improvement in both their own methods and in the performance of the sales teams they support.

What is an insurance sales trainer?

An Insurance Sales Trainer is responsible for educating and coaching insurance sales agents to improve their performance and product knowledge. They develop training programs, conduct workshops, and provide ongoing support to enhance sales techniques and customer service skills. Trainers often stay updated on industry trends, company policies, and regulatory requirements to ensure agents are well-informed. Their goal is to increase sales effectiveness, boost agent confidence, and ensure compliance with industry standards.

Job description

Hertvik Insurance Group is seeking a motivated, results-driven Sales Representative to join our Personal Lines team. This is a high-activity sales role focused exclusively on warm, referral-based leads. You'll be connecting with people who are actively purchasing a home and have a real, immediate need for homeowners insurance. Your job is simple: work the lead, earn their trust, quote the right coverage, and close the sale. Once the policy is sold, our service team takes it from there so you can stay focused on selling..
